Ongoing Parking Cars for Charity Through the generosity of the Hampshire First Bank located at 80 Canal Street, the Kiwanis Club of Manchester has been appointed to manage the Bank’s parking facilities on the days and evenings that the Fisher Cats are playing and also on the days and evenings that the Verizon Wireless Arena has activity. The Kiwanis Club will be allowed to distribute all of the monies collected from this project to local charitable groups in the greater Manchester area that meet the Club’s criteria of helping kids.

May 10, 2008 Fish With A Child Club members take inner city children fishing at a local pond. It is a fun day for all and for some of the children it is the first time they have experienced fishing.

December 2008 Walk with a Child Members of the Kiwanis Club of Manchester will take 40 boys and girls from the Manchester Boys and Girls Club shopping at Wal-Mart for warm winter clothing. This is an annual event that Club members and their friends and families participate in and enjoy.
